Output 959724c4fe558e2d509b3e8f2becc199f1c736edad2193b7e29d2ad2793c1b75:4

value
7504629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 864d270ade7cce0a84eca12937a923fa9726886b OP_EQUAL
address
3Dw8tu7kcQ88EFBmfaHrEoZJmPnes3K2z6
transaction
959724c4fe558e2d509b3e8f2becc199f1c736edad2193b7e29d2ad2793c1b75
spent
true